## Further reading

If you're new to TumbleKey, the laundry-locker access flow is the gnarliest bit of the codebase — lockers can be claimed, held, expired, or orphaned, and each state has its own unlock rules. Before touching anything in the access module, skim the state diagram and the token-handoff notes from the Bramleigh pilot. Both live on the internal design doc here.

runbook for kageg-yafof: https://jira.norvalabs.test/board/view/secrets/job/ticket/board/board/2bc6c981aafb1e8fe00a8459

## Payslip Transport — Marrowgate Depot

Marrowgate Depot has no on-site printer, so payslips for warehouse staff are printed centrally at the Old Quay office and sealed in tamper-evident envelopes. A courier brings them every second Thursday. The shift lead signs the manifest and distributes them same day. The courier hand-over instruction follows below.

handover note for yagef-bagep: the drudor pelius courier leaves the kasdor zorvan norir ledger at gate 8016 under passcode 755406

## Sensor drift: what to do at 3am

If the GrowLoop controller starts reporting humidity swings that don't match the backup probes in the Fernwick greenhouse, it's almost always sensor drift, not an actual climate event. Don't panic and don't touch the vents manually. First, restart the calibration daemon and give it ten minutes to re-baseline. If readings still disagree by more than 5%, flip the controller into safe mode. The safe-mode thresholds it will use are these.

config for yahap-bajof:
[istix]
host = istix.qorvelsys.internal
user = istix_svc
database = istix_prod